A short explanation about the Caeon.

The Luak tribe is like the army. It is the second largest tribe too. But the Caeon are made of five tribes.

The Tarant are the earth tribe. After the Luak burn and build a little and than leave to conquer more the Tarant tribe comes and builds more, much more. They are the villagers and workers. They also begin the assimilation of other groups into us.

Than comes the Gilio, the wind tribe. They are the religious workers and priests. They bring forward much more assimilation but do not work. The Tarant work for them to let them do the job of assimilation. They also command the building of temples for the five creation gods.

There are also the Yumua. The water tribe. They are like the higher workers and, believe it or not, traders of the Caeon. They are rather shunned by the rest but are accepted for one cannot rule all without a little trade when needed.

And last but not least are the wolololo. The Spirit tribe. They are the rulers. They are the smallest but strongest tribe. They are the Wiseman, the scientists and inventors. They are the artist and architectures. Their leader is the nation leader. He is the Oracle. Every time an Oracle dies a new one takes place. An Oracle can come from any of the tribes and he usually means what the country will do for his lifetime. (Wars, building, trading, assimilation or...) well no or. There has not been a second spirit oracle since the first. I will explain later. Also there has not been a water oracle since their ways are shunned and not really accepted by anyone. But the first did order the water tribe to handle trade and outer diplomacy, the problem is that they took it too far, but he couldn't demand them to stop and so they retained their ways.
